Inclusion Criteria:
- American Society of Anesthesiologists physical status II parturients.
- Full term, singleton pregnancy
- Elective cesarean delivery under spinal anesthesia
Exclusion Criteria:
- Height <150 cm
- Weight <60 kg
- Body mass index (BMI) <18.5 or ≥ 35 kg/m²
- Women presenting in labor
- Contraindications to spinal anesthesia: increased intracranial pressure, coagulopathy, or local skin infection
- Hemoglobin <10 g/dL
- Current administration of vasoactive drugs (e.g., salbutamol, thyroxin)
- Diabetes mellitus, cardiovascular, or renal disease
- Chronic or pregnancy-induced hypertension
- Polyhydramnios
- Women with high risk for postpartum hemorrhage or uterine atony (e.g., placenta accreta spectrum, ≥3 previous cesarean deliveries)

Study Group
Cardiac output will be measured at baseline using transthoracic echocardiography.
Spinal anesthesia will be administered with injection of intrathecal bupivacaine and intrathecal fentanyl.
Crystalloid coload 1000 mL will be administered: Ringer acetate 1000 mL will be administered over 10 minutes starting immediately after intrathecal injection.
Cardiac output will be measured at 10 minutes after intrathecal injection, immediately after delivery, at 1 hour after intrathecal injection.
Cesarean delivery will be performed.
Intravenous ephedrine will be administered to correct hypotension.
After delivery, 10 units of oxytocin in 500 ml Ringer acetate will be administered over 30 minutes.
|
Bupivacaine 12.5 mg (2.5 mL 0.5%) will be administered in the subarachnoid space
Fentanyl 15 μg will be administered in the subarachnoid space
Intravenous ephedrine 3, 5, and 10 mg will be administered when Systolic blood pressure decreases below 90%, 80%, and 70% of baseline, respectively.
Measurement of cardiac output in supine position with left lateral tilt at baseline, at 10 minutes after intrathecal injection, immediately after delivery, and at 1 hour after intrathecal injection
Performed at the L3-L4 or L4-L5 interspace using 25-gauge spinal needle
Ringer acetate 1000 mL will be administered over 10 minutes starting immediately after intrathecal injection
Lower segment cesarean section using the Pfannenstiel incision and uterine exteriorization
Intravenous oxytocin 10 U in 500 mL Ringer acetate will be administered over 30 minutes starting immediately after delivery of the fetus
